Projekt: Railworks-Manager


Abonniere unseren Kanal auf WhatsApp (klicke hier zum abonnieren).
  • Ist mir Schleierhaft warum Virenscanner das Programm bemängeln. Natürlich kannst Du das Ignorieren.


    Weiteres:
    Wenn ein Routenordner mit Nummer existiert aber nur Scenerien enthalten sind, wird das nicht abgefragt. Ich weis nicht wie ich dann an die RoutenProperties dieser nicht existierenden Route komme. Ebenso gibt es keine Verknüpfung der Aufgabe mit der Route. Ich konnte das nicht testen, da bei mir keine leeren Strecken vorhanden sind.


    Ich habe nicht damit gerechnet das es soviele Probleme gibt. Das Programm wurde Hundertmale getestet und läuft einwandfrei. Nicht nur bei mir.


    Vielleicht gibt es ja von jemanden eine Resonanz, und schreibt hier mal, ob alles funktioniert.


    Wie bei uns im Web geschrieben:
    Der Korsoft Railworks Manager ist von Privatpersonen für die persönliche Nutzung geschrieben.
    Da wir es aber schade fanden ihn nur für uns zu benutzen, haben wir ihn für den Download frei gegeben. Ich überlege jetzt, ob das ein Fehler war...
    Ich nehme mich gerne der Fehler an, und versuche sie zu verbessern oder zu reparieren.
    Dieses Programm ist in meiner Freizeit entstanden mit Spaß am Programmieren.


    Auch komisch hier, warum kann ich jetzt nur noch ein neues Thema erstellen und nicht Antworten wie sonst.. Vielleicht ist es die Späte Stunde.



    Und schon ist ein Update da:


    Update V1.1:
    1 . Beim Pfad anlegen wird geprüft, ob der Trainsim auch wirklich im angegebenen Ort liegt. (Bitte erneut in den Einstellungen auf Speichern gehen)
    2. Sollten im Routen-Ordner keine Route existieren sondern nur Scenerien, wird diese komplett übersprungen.(Sorry)


    Jetzt ist aber Schlafenszeit für mich.
    Gruß Chris

  • Hallo, das war kein Fehler das zu veröffentlichen!


    Nobody and Software is never perfect!


    Sone umfangreiche Software kann nicht zu 100% fertig bzw "fehlerfrei" sein, die Leute reagieren immer anders als geplant und haben nicht die Testumgebung, wie man selbst.
    Du reagierst richtig: toll das es gleich ein Update gab. Aber deswegen nicht die Nacht zum Tag machen. In Ruhe drüber schlafen hilft meist.


    Ich hab versucht nur das Update zum 1.1 zu Installieren, das sucht ein sqlite.dll, dass man in den Ordner kopieren soll.
    Gut neue Version, neues .dll,
    IM internet gibts: https://www.sqlite.org/download.html
    Nur da komm das gleiche Sqlite3.dll was schon vorhanden ist.
    Nur ging nix mehr, ich sehe es sportlich, wird halt die Grundversion nochmal installiert.
    Nur wie kommt man an den Download, wenn sich die Installation zerschossen hat ?

    Keine Hilfe und Auskunft per PN, da meist von allgemeinem Interesse. Diese Fragen bitte im Forum stellen.

    Einmal editiert, zuletzt von StS ()

  • Also, wir arbeiten kräftig an dem nächsten Update wo wir auch Eure Vorschläge mit einbringen...
    Ich werde hier und bei uns bescheid geben...


    Gruß Chris


    P.S: @StSDas Update v1.1 besteh nur aus dem eigentlichem Programm, nur überbügeln dann wäre die Sache mit der sqlite.dll erledigt

  • Ich habe das ein bisschen versucht. Es sieht gut aus (obwohl Farben verwendet werden könnten, um die Tasten leichter erkennbar zu machen) und wird sich wahrscheinlich als sehr nützlich erweisen. Besonders gut gefällt mir die Szenariosuchfunktion, bei der der wahre Mehrwert dieses Programms für mich liegt.


    Ich war enttäuscht, und ich kann mir vorstellen, dass es viele andere sind, weil zu Beginn die lästige Anforderung bestand, nicht nur Pfade zu TS, sondern auch zu einem Bildeditor, PDF-Reader, HTML-Editor usw. einzurichten, und das alles Benötigte Felder. Am Ende habe ich für die meisten Dummy-Einträge gesetzt, nur um weitermachen zu können. Ich denke, das sollte geändert werden - sicherlich ist der Pfad zu TS erforderlich, aber können einige der anderen nicht optional sein? Außerdem fand ich es verwirrend, dass der Pfad zu TS effektiv zweimal eingegeben werden musste, in beiden Fällen einschließlich der EXE-Datei - was ist der Unterschied?


    Beim Erstellen der Routendatenbank blieb das Programm hängen. Ich denke, dies kann daran liegen, dass ich doppelte Einträge in meinem Routenordner habe. Zum Beispiel, zusätzlich zum Ordner "0be2db37-c4e6-4ae1-b640-997630117850" habe ich einen separaten, leeren Ordner "0be2db37-c4e6-4ae1-" b640-997630117850 DE S-Bahn Rhein-Main ". Gleiches gilt für alle anderen Routen. Dies macht es einfach, jede Route im Routenordner zu erkennen und manuell zu verschieben, aber möglicherweise bereiten diese leeren Ordner dem Programm Schwierigkeiten.


    Eine Option, die ich auch gerne sehen würde, ist das Finden eines Szenarios basierend auf der Zeit - um 22:00 Uhr spiele ich gerne ein Szenario, das tatsächlich um diese Zeit eingestellt ist. Die aktuelle Beta bietet bereits die Möglichkeit, Szenarien basierend auf Wetter und Jahreszeit zu finden, jedoch noch nicht basierend auf der Startzeit. Wäre es möglich, dies hinzuzufügen? Vielleicht könnten Zeitfenster verwendet werden - 06:00-08:00, 08:00-10:00 usw.?


    Danke vielmals!


    (Übersetzt mit Google Translate)

  • Zum Beispiel, zusätzlich zum Ordner "0be2db37-c4e6-4ae1-b640-997630117850" habe ich einen separaten, leeren Ordner "0be2db37-c4e6-4ae1-" b640-997630117850 DE S-Bahn Rhein-Main "

    Mach aus den Hinweis-Ordner Text-Dateien mit dem selben Namen z.B: 0be2db37-c4e6-4ae1-b640-997630117850 DE S-Bahn Rhein-Main.txt, irgendeinen Dummy-text rein, damit die Datei bei 0-byte-Dateifehler-Suche nicht rausfliegt.

    Keine Hilfe und Auskunft per PN, da meist von allgemeinem Interesse. Diese Fragen bitte im Forum stellen.

  • Zu den Pfadeingaben braucht wirklich eine Anleitung, Ich glaub ich habs richtig aus den Desktop-Verküpfungen rauskopiert, mit "" weil Pfade mit Leerzeichen sonst von Windowns nicht verarbeitet weren, Leerzeichen ist immer Zeichen Pfad zu Ende, jetzt kommt nächste Anweisung.
    Bestes Beispiel selber von Microsoft vermurkst: C:\Program Files (x86) die Leerzeichen hat schon vielen Programmieren graue Haare verpasst.
    Nur das Programm hat auch Probleme damit:



    Schlichter Versuch eine RoutesProperties über das ICON: "RoutesProperties öffnen mit Editor" zu öffnen auf der Routen mit Aufgaben Maske.
    Vermutlicher Grund des Problems: in der Ersten Zeile der Pfadangabe: D:\Program Files (x86)\Steam\steamapps\common\RailWorks werden keine einschliessenden "" zugelassen, sonst mault das Programm.


    Dann bitte beim Pfadbau entsprechend mit den Leerzeichen umgehen.

    Keine Hilfe und Auskunft per PN, da meist von allgemeinem Interesse. Diese Fragen bitte im Forum stellen.

  • Die Assets lassen, zu viele Kreuz- und Querabhängigkeiten.
    Aber was hat sich den da noch auf der SSD eingenistet? das Zeug kommt bestimmt mit einer "normalen" HD aus, wetten?
    Das clean-Assets-Tool räumt auch gerne mal den mitgelieferten Entwicklungsmist aus dem Assets-Ordner.

    Oder man verwendet WIndows Symbolic Links. Wird häufig in Flugsim benutzt. Mit diesem Tool hierunten ganz einfach. TS auf SSD und bestimmte Assets (z.B. Assets die nicht oft benutzt werden) verlinkt auf HD.


    https://schinagl.priv.at/nt/ha…t/linkshellextension.html

  • Version 1.2 ist nun veröffentlicht und steht seit dem 28.05.2020 zum Download bereit !!



    Update V1.2:

    AP-Dateien werden Ignoriert. Existiert RouteProperties.xml wird eingelesen.

    Lok HTML angepasst in der Datenbank.

    Loks von nicht vorhandenen Providern werden ignoriert.

    Zwei Möglichkeiten zum Zuordnen der Lok-PDF geschaffen. Beliebiges Verzeichniss oder Railworks-Manual Verzeichniss.

    Prozeduren für die Sicherung eigener Daten in separate Datenbank überarbeitet.

    Tabelle Loks um ein Datenfeld erweitert.

    ErrorLog.txt hinzugefügt.

    Konfigurations-Fenster Pfadangaben nur Pflicht bei TS-Verzeichnis und ausgelagerte Routen.



    ACHTUNG ! Datenbank wurde geändert. Bitte alte Version komplett löschen. (Es gibt keine DeInstallation)

    3 Mal editiert, zuletzt von BNSF () aus folgendem Grund: Webseite gibt es nicht mehr

  • Sorry, aber das Ding zu installieren ist eine Krux.
    Ich hatte noch die alte Korsoft Railworks Manager Setup.exe, die lies sich nicht so einfach löschen, damit die Neue ausgepackt werden kann. Die wollte Rechte von meinem Rechner haben ... Ich hab die dann doch überedet in den Papierkorb zu verschwinden.
    Jetzt ausgepackt, Avira die Korsoft Railworks Manager Setup.exe wieder als Ausnahme eingetragen,
    Dann das:

    ????

    Keine Hilfe und Auskunft per PN, da meist von allgemeinem Interesse. Diese Fragen bitte im Forum stellen.

  • Sorry ihr lieben, aber bei mir läuft kein Antivirus Programm, nur das hauseigene von Windows 10 und das ist sehr vertrauenswürdig. Ehrlich, Ich möchte mich jetzt nicht übels über die Antiviren Programme auslassen, Aber lasst es einfach sein mit den Teilen.. die sind für alle solche Probleme verantwortlich. Installiert Programme nur auf ein Lauferk anders als C: dann gibt es auch keine Rechte-Propleme. Ob ihr was in die Ausnahme einträgt oder nicht, das ist den Teilen echt egal. Deinstaliere es und Du wirst sehen, es geht. Ich habe das zu genüge selbst erlebt, deshalb kommt mir kein Antivirus-Programm ins Haus...Weil Avira dein System in der Hand hat, kann das Setup sich nicht selbst lesen... Jedes Antivirus Programm checkt jede Datei auf Dein System. Neue Programme hat es fest in der Hand. Dein System wird auch dadurch verlangsamt. Aber ich lass das lieber, das führt hier zu weit. Ich bin Seit Windows 3.1 über 95/98 bis nach XP, 7 und Win10 dabei. Ich denke, das ich weis wovon ich rede...


    Gruß Chris


    P.S. wer hat denn noch Probleme es zu installieren ?

  • @BNSF
    komisch, die Version 1 und 1.1 konnte ich mit Ausnahme als administrator installieren.


    Die Version 1.2 hat ebenfalls die Ausnahme und die Installation unter Administrator-Rechten lief an. Dann kam der Fehler.
    Übrigens ich hab immer auf D: installiert, indem ich mich dahin durchgehangelt habe!


    Aber wer nicht will der hat.

    Keine Hilfe und Auskunft per PN, da meist von allgemeinem Interesse. Diese Fragen bitte im Forum stellen.

    Einmal editiert, zuletzt von StS ()

  • Szenarioproperies.xml zu finden in der Strecke und da im Szenario mit der ID mit Notepad++ editieren und in die Zeile 107 schauen was komisches in den Texten steht, meist schwarz markiert. Das rauslöschen, gleich weiterschauen ob da noch mehr drin sind, auch entfernen, abspeichern.
    Dann Update neu starten.

    Keine Hilfe und Auskunft per PN, da meist von allgemeinem Interesse. Diese Fragen bitte im Forum stellen.

    Einmal editiert, zuletzt von StS ()

  • @BNSF
    Gut, schichtes Ausnahme verordnen reicht nicht, Virenscanner komplett deaktivien muss leider sein.
    (Übrigens bei mir seit x Jahren und x-hundert Exe-Installationen zum ersten Mal!, gut Avira will auch mal Flagge zeigen....)
    Ich bin ja harttnäckig, ich lass mir nicht vorschreiben was und wie ich installiere.
    Es hat geklappt.
    Pfade eingetragen :
    D:\Program Files (x86)\Steam\steamapps\common\RailWorks\RailWorks.exe
    Datenbank aktualisiert:
    Info das meinte ich mit Lapsus: (ich häng die Bilder hier an, im hauseigenen Forum gehts ja nicht)



    Drei Hinweise in den Error.log geschrieben !


    Sonst liefs braf brav durch. die .xml Fehler waren ja schon repariert.


    dann mal da drauf geklickt.


    Dann das:



    Der Pad wird nicht richtig zusammengebastelt!
    Da der Pfad zu Railworks Leerzeichen enthält, den ""-Trick der Pfade in Verknüpfungen eingebaut:


    Dann kommt das:

    warum sucht das Programm jetzt da?

    Keine Hilfe und Auskunft per PN, da meist von allgemeinem Interesse. Diese Fragen bitte im Forum stellen.

    2 Mal editiert, zuletzt von StS ()

  • Wenn Du das von meinem Beispiel abgeschrieben hast, dann sollte bei Dir auch auf D: der Ordner TS2020 existieren und das denke ich ist bei Dir nicht der Fall, sonnst würdest Du nicht die Fehlermeldung erhalten !


    Für die Allgemeinheit:
    Da wir nicht so viel Zeit in anderen Foren zubringen können und die wenige Zeit, die wir hierfür zu Verfügung haben, lieber in die Weiterentwicklung des Korsoft Railworks Managers investieren, werden Deine Fragen und Anregungen nur in unserem Forum verfolgt.
    Wir bitten um Verständnis !
    (BilderUpload ist auch eingerichtet)


    P.S: V1.3 verfügbar
    Gruß Chris

  • Update V1.4:

    Pfadfehler beim Ausführen von Editor und Bildbearbeitungsprogramm beseitigt

    Fehlende Ausführung im Aufgabeneditor XMLEditor berichtigt.

    Konfiguration / Pfadeinstellung überarbeitet.



    Zum Forum



    Gruß Chris

    2 Mal editiert, zuletzt von BNSF () aus folgendem Grund: Webseite gibt es nicht mehr